The protective relaying is used in electrical substations to give an alarm or to cause prompt removal of any element of the power system from service when that element behaves abnormally. Emr (electromechanical relay), ssr (solid state relay), hybrid. The relay is a crucial substation component. The protection relay senses the electrical quantities, such as current and voltage, and sends a trip command to the circuit breaker to disconnect the faulty part. The overcurrent and earth fault relays are used for feeder protection. Introduction to relay and different types of relays | it's terminals, working and applications. Protective relays and devices have been developed over 100 years ago to provide “last line” of defense for the electrical systems.
